BLS metro-level wage data places English Language and Literature Teachers, Postsecondary pay in New Orleans-Metairie, LA at a median of $69,740 per year, drawn from the OEWS May 2025 release for this Metropolitan Statistical Area. Compared to the national median of $78,760, New Orleans-Metairie pays 11% below, which typically tracks with a lower local cost of living or smaller specialized-employer cluster. Approximately 110 english language and literature teachers, postsecondarys are employed across the New Orleans-Metairie MSA in SOC 25-1123.
The New Orleans-Metairie pay distribution spans from $48,620 at the 10th percentile to $121,960 at the 90th — a 2.5× spread that reflects experience tenure, specialization, employer size, and the difference between public-sector, nonprofit, and private-sector compensation inside the metro. The 25th percentile sits at $56,790 and the 75th at $100,790, so half of New Orleans-Metairie-based english language and literature teachers, postsecondarys earn within that middle band.

BLS draws metro boundaries from the OMB MSA definitions, so New Orleans-Metairie, LA covers the central city plus outlying counties tied to the metro economically. Remember that OEWS wages reflect base pay only: employer-provided health insurance, retirement matches, stock options, signing bonuses, overtime, and tips are excluded and can add 20-40% to real total compensation.
